This is the Softpulse installer which bundles applications with offers for additional 3rd party software, mostly unwanted adware, and may be installed with minimal consent. The application setup.exe by Plugin Update S.L has been detected as adware by 1 anti-malware scanner with very strong indications that the file is a potential threat. The program is a setup application that uses the Softpulse SoftwareBundler installer. The file has been seen being downloaded from flash.zuqiuing.com.
